This magazine is in a completely different sphere from the majority of the home improvement magazines. Not only is in pan-European but it concentrates more on the cutting edge of design and architecture. I first discovered in when helping with a translation job for a lighting company and have found it to be great for someone who is thinking about how to do up a flat, and for whom a home is more than merely a place to eat and sleep. Working from my flat, I need the place to look professional, whilst not losing the homely touch. Wallpaper offers the best information, tips and whilst it is not really of interest to your DIY fans it has a certain appeal to anyone wanting to make their home classy.

Many people claim that Wallpaper is expensive, but at GBP3.60 every two months I find this claim hard to substantiate. Female visitors to my flat also seem to love it that I seem to care about the appearance of my flat.
